The stock spoiler on our cars actually serves a purpose. It breaks up the airflow over the tail so you don't create a vacuum back there. I've seen this in 'dew trails' in the mornings with my car on several occasions. You can track the air movement after a short trip.

That thing is simply giving in to the pointless ricer tuner market. Where they spend money and add weight to make their cars LOOK faster. The Fast and the Furious was FICTION. By driving around with that thing on your car, you're giving every decent person out there the preconcieved notion that you are from that crowd, and that crowd is not liked.
